What Is the Key Differences Between Plastic Surgery and Cosmetic Surgery
A large number of individuals mix up when they hear the terms reconstructive surgery and cosmetic surgery. Even though both procedures enhance the body, they have distinct goals.
Reconstructive surgery focuses on repairing affected body parts caused by trauma, medical conditions, or birth defects. This type of surgery helps patients restore functionality and improve their natural appearance.
In many cases, patients recovering from cancer treatment may need reconstructive surgery to restore the structure and look of the breast.
Meanwhile, cosmetic surgery is performed to improve a person’s looks. Unlike plastic surgery, these treatments are usually elective, meaning patients choose them to enhance their body shape.
Aesthetic treatments target areas such as the body contour. Many people often search online to remove stubborn fat and boost confidence.
Even though the surgical methods may overlap, their objectives are distinct.
Reconstructive surgery is concerned with repairing abnormalities, while aesthetic procedures aim at improving appearance.
From a medical perspective, reconstructive procedures are often required for health reasons, whereas cosmetic surgery are optional.
Common reconstructive procedures include post-cancer reconstruction. Popular aesthetic procedures include skin rejuvenation.
